
One of the most exciting times of the year for baseball fans is January. The Baseball Hall of Fame is about to announce its 2024 inductees and Spring Training is just a few dozen sleeps away.
Baseball card fans also look forward to this time of year as well. Topps typically drops its iconic flagship release in February and as that date gets closer, collectors gear up for the official unveiling of the latest design.
As of January 11th, collectors have to wait no longer as Topps released a hype video of its latest “electric” release.
In an additional tweet on Thursday afternoon, other mockups were released of Mike Trout and Alex Bregman
In the video, Cincinnati Reds star Elly De La Cruz gets the honor of showcasing the 2024 Topps design.
The card includes an oversized border separated by color-matched lined neon lights. The team name is in the right upper-hand corner whereas the team logo is in the lower left-hand corner. An italicized name is in the lower right-hand corner but is thankfully not as obnoxious as the 2021 Topps design, which was surrounded by a color box and smaller.
In the Elly De La Cruz card, the border is a mix of white with a gradient into black for the top portion of the card. After cards of Trout and Bregman were unvieled, the assumption is that the border would be the same color on all cards minus the neon portion of the card.
Initial reaction to the design seems to be mostly positive with come of the biggest negatives coming from the border, with some not liking the black border and others saying the border is too large.
